Scope
This document describes the first discharge specific capacity and the first charge-discharge efficiency test methods of lithium manganese oxide, a cathode material for lithium-ion batteries.
This document is applicable to the first discharge specific capacity and the first charge-discharge efficiency test of lithium manganese oxide, a cathode material for lithium-ion batteries. The test methods include the button-type half-cell method and the button-type full-cell method.
